2. What is the equation of a line parallel to y = -5x + 3 that passes through (3, 1)?

Mathematics
2 answers:
KIM [24]4 years ago
8 0

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

line parallel to given line has same slope i.e.,-5

eq. of line through (3,1) with slope -5 is

y-1=-5(x-3)

y-1=-5x+15

y=-5x+15+1

or y=-5x+16

Generally what do the elements in a group have in common with each other?
Tatiana [17]

They have the same number of valence electrons which, in general, gives them similar oxidation numbers and other similar chemical and physical properties. The similarities are most pronounced in the groups at either side of the standard periodic table, and are least pronounced for the transition and rare earth elements.
